
As the county seat for Monterey County, Salinas, California, is a thriving community that is filled with agricultural and manufacturing businesses. The location near the mouth of the Salinas River and just about 15 miles from Monterey Bay means that the soil is rich and moist, making it the ideal location to cultivate lettuce, broccoli, strawberries, and many other produce items, earning the town the nickname the “Salad Bowl of the World”. The community is also the home of the California Rodeo and the California International Airshow, as well as being the birthplace of John Steinbeck.

What Is The Time Limit To File My Salinas, California Accident Injury Lawsuit?
As the victim of personal injuries, you are typically allotted two years to file your case with the court. The legal system strictly enforced this time limit, and once it has expired, you no longer have the right to pursue legal action related to this specific accident injury incident. In addition, there are minimal exceptions that would allow an accident injury victim to add time to file a lawsuit once the original time limit has passed.
It is also critical to understand that in California, there is a different time limit imposed on the victim when the responsible party in a personal injury case is a government entity or agency. For example, if you were involved in a vehicle accident or pedestrian accident that was the result of negligence of a city employee who was driving a Salinas vehicle, you would need to be aware of the shorter time limit to take legal action. In these cases, the victim’s time to pursue and file a lawsuit is reduced to only six months from the date of the injury incident.
